Why should you watch this video? Because talking about your day is the foundation of real communication. When you meet new people, teachers, or friends, the first question they often ask is “How was your day?” or “What did you do today?” If you can answer confidently, you will feel more relaxed and ready to continue the conversation. This video will guide you step by step, showing you useful words, phrases, and examples that you can use immediately in your daily life.
We will cover how to start your sentences, how to connect ideas, and how to make your speaking sound natural. For example, instead of just saying “I woke up,” you will learn to say “I woke up early because I wanted to exercise.” This makes your English more interesting and shows your personality. You will also learn how to use time words like “in the morning,” “after lunch,” and “before bed” to organize your story.

We will also give you motivational tips. Many learners think their English is not good enough, but the truth is that practice makes progress. Talking about your day is something you can do every single day. You don’t need a partner or a classroom. You can practice alone, in front of a mirror, or even record yourself. This video will inspire you to keep going and remind you that mistakes are part of learning.
